Youngistaan

A few years ago, Pepsi started an ad campaign with Ranbir Kapoor that was proudly called ‘Youngistaan’. It was supposed to be youth-oriented, hep, and about how India is a land of youngsters. It was also one of the worst ad campaigns that any soft drink company has ever run. One that, for some reason, they continue to stick with to this day. Now, Syed Ahmad Afzal’s ‘Youngistaan’ – The Movie is supposed to be youth-oriented, hep, and about how India is a land of youngsters. It also starts off with a disclaimer that says that they are not affiliated with the Pepsi campaign in any way. Here’s the thing! When even the worst ad campaign in history doesn’t want to be associated with you, maybe it’s a good idea to rethink the product that you’re putting out. Unfortunately, this film starring Jackky Bhagnani as India’s reluctant 28-year-old Prime Minister does none of that. They say that the movie is never as good as the book it’s based on. Turns out, this is doubly true for movies based on shitty ad campaigns.
